首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Python中矩阵的R等效项

在Python中,矩阵的R等效项指的是使用R语言中的矩阵运算功能时,Python中的等效替代方法。R语言是一种统计分析和图形绘制的编程语言,它在数据处理和统计建模方面非常强大。而Python也是一种常用的编程语言,它在科学计算和数据分析领域有着广泛的应用。

在Python中,我们可以使用NumPy库来进行类似于R语言中的矩阵运算。NumPy是Python中用于科学计算的基础库,提供了高效的数组操作和数学函数。

要实现矩阵运算中的R等效项,我们可以使用NumPy中的ndarray对象来表示矩阵,并使用相关的函数进行运算。以下是一些常用的矩阵运算功能及其在NumPy中的等效替代方法:

  1. 矩阵加法:R语言中使用"+"运算符,而在NumPy中可以使用np.add函数实现。
  2. 示例代码:
  3. 示例代码:
  4. 矩阵乘法:R语言中使用"*"运算符,而在NumPy中可以使用np.dot函数实现。
  5. 示例代码:
  6. 示例代码:
  7. 矩阵转置:R语言中使用t函数,而在NumPy中可以使用ndarray对象的T属性实现。
  8. 示例代码:
  9. 示例代码:
  10. 矩阵逆运算:R语言中使用solve函数,而在NumPy中可以使用np.linalg.inv函数实现。
  11. 示例代码:
  12. 示例代码:

通过使用NumPy库,Python可以很好地实现矩阵运算中的R等效项。NumPy提供了丰富的函数和方法,能够满足不同的矩阵运算需求。对于更复杂的统计分析和建模任务,还可以结合其他专门的库如SciPy、pandas等来进一步扩展功能。

腾讯云相关产品和产品介绍链接地址:

  • 腾讯云产品首页
  • 云服务器CVM:提供灵活可靠的云服务器实例,适用于各类应用场景。
  • 云数据库MySQL:高性能、可扩展的云数据库服务,支持弹性扩容、备份恢复等功能。
  • 云原生应用引擎TKE:提供弹性高可用的容器集群管理服务,方便部署和管理容器化应用。
  • 人工智能AI平台:提供多种人工智能服务和工具,包括图像识别、自然语言处理等。
  • 物联网IoT Hub:可靠安全的物联网设备接入和管理平台,支持海量设备连接和数据传输。
  • 移动开发服务HMS:提供全方位的移动开发服务,包括应用分发、推送通知、统计分析等。
  • 云存储COS:安全可靠的云存储服务,适用于各类数据存储和管理需求。
  • 区块链服务BCS:提供简单易用的区块链网络搭建和管理服务,支持智能合约等功能。
  • 腾讯云游戏引擎Cocos:强大的游戏开发引擎和工具集,支持多平台游戏开发。
  • 元宇宙MARS:腾讯云自主研发的元宇宙解决方案,提供虚拟世界建模和交互功能。

请注意,以上推荐的腾讯云产品仅供参考,具体选择应根据实际需求和情况进行。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 每日论文速递 | 用于参数高效微调的小型集成LoRA

    摘要:参数高效微调(PEFT)是一种流行的方法,用于裁剪预训练的大型语言模型(LLM),特别是随着模型规模和任务多样性的增加。低秩自适应(LoRA)基于自适应过程本质上是低维的想法,即,显著的模型变化可以用相对较少的参数来表示。然而,与全参数微调相比,降低秩会遇到特定任务的泛化错误的挑战。我们提出了MELoRA,一个迷你合奏低秩适配器,使用较少的可训练参数,同时保持较高的排名,从而提供更好的性能潜力。其核心思想是冻结原始的预训练权重,并训练一组只有少量参数的迷你LoRA。这可以捕获迷你LoRA之间的显著程度的多样性,从而促进更好的泛化能力。我们对各种NLP任务进行了理论分析和实证研究。我们的实验结果表明,与LoRA相比,MELoRA在自然语言理解任务中的可训练参数减少了8倍,在指令跟随任务中的可训练参数减少了36倍,从而实现了更好的性能,这证明了MELoRA的有效性。

    01
    领券